About GCMG GCM Grosvenor Inc.

GCM Grosvenor Inc is a world-wide alternative asset management firm. It invests on behalf of clients who seek allocations to alternative investments, such as private equity, infrastructure, real estate, credit, ESG and absolute return strategies. Company invest maximum in Private Equity. The company's offerings include multi-manager portfolios as well as portfolios of direct investments and co-investments.

About DGICB Donegal Group Inc. Class B

Donegal Group Inc is an insurance holding company whose insurance subsidiaries and affiliates offer property and casualty insurance in 21 Mid-Atlantic, Midwestern, Southern, and Southwestern states. It includes three segments: Investments Function, Commercial Lines of Insurance, and Personal Lines of Insurance. The majority of revenue is from the commercial Lines segment. The commercial Lines segment consists mainly of commercial automobile, commercial multi-peril, and workers' compensation policies.
